AARP Foundation Leadership


The AARP Foundation Board of Directors is composed of seven individuals, and includes four members of the AARP Board of Directors and the CEO of AARP.

Board members are elected to serve two-year terms. These individuals are leaders in their fields and usually hold other positions with the boards of foundations, associations, and a variety of public and private organizations. They are selected based on their record of achievement and commitment to the issues of interest to the AARP Foundation and represent the rich diversity of the American population. For the 2004-2006 Biennium, the AARP Foundation Board of Directors is composed of the following people:

Chair: Jennie Chin Hansen
Board Member: Clarence Pearson
Board Member: Pat Lewis
Secretary/Ex-Officio Member: William D. Novelli
Board Member: N. Joyce Payne
Board Member: Nelda Barnett
Board Member: Vacant
